Abstract | Bearing in mind United Nations' 2030 agenda and achievement of global goals, the conference theme brings attention to exploration of how education adjusted to the unexpected challenges of the global crisis and how lessons learnt can be used to create better education systems. On that note, this perspective piece brings attention to sustainable development and especially sustainable development goal 4 specific to education as well as the VUCA times representative of the fast-page changing world. Description of the above-mentioned notions is connected to the vision of higher education sector as a sustainable service provider. Higher education institutions play an essential role in sustainability since they are not only knowledge producers but most importantly agents nurturing educators, researchers and leaders with potential to contribute to the successful achievement of the United Nations' Sustainable Development Goals. The paper culminates with reflections and considerations about the direction higher education sector should consider to build back better.
